Arts & Culture Strategy
Nicholas also brings deep experience in the arts world through hands-on administration, cultural institution leadership, and nonprofit work. He has managed major exhibitions like Ashes & Snow (which drew 500K+ visitors), led patron groups at institutions like FIAF Alliance Française and The Watermill Center, and created Cords for Music, a social enterprise that funded music education for NYC public school students. He holds a Master's in Arts Administration from Columbia University.
This cultural experience means he understands how arts organizations operate, what they value, and how to build authentic partnerships between brands and creative communities.
